
Arsenal legend Thierry Henry will NOT become Julian Nagelsmann's assistant manager at Paris Saint-Germain.
The young German head coach is PSG's prime target as they look to reset the club after a poor season in the Champions League.
Henry had been slated to join Nageslmann, but Foot Mercato states he is reluctant to take on the assistant job.
The ex-attacker is preferring a spell in England, where his family lives, as he thinks about his professional future.
Henry, according to Le Parisien, is more interested in finding a head coaching position.
He believes that he has done enough work as an assistant, especially from his time with the Belgian national team.
